Responsibilities
- Conduct comprehensive diagnostics using automotive electrical systems, schematics, and advanced diagnostic tools to identify mechanical and electronic issues.
- Perform repairs on various vehicle systems including engines, transmissions, suspensions, brakes, shocks & struts, and powertrain components.
- Execute routine maintenance such as oil changes, tire services, wheel alignments, and vehicle inspections to uphold safety standards.
- Repair and replace components on diesel engines, heavy equipment, and GM vehicles when applicable.
- Utilize hand tools, power tools, welding equipment, and other mechanical tools to complete repairs efficiently and accurately.
- Interpret technical manuals and schematics to troubleshoot complex mechanical systems repair tasks effectively.
- Provide exceptional customer service by explaining repairs clearly and ensuring customer satisfaction with the service provided.
